Asian-Pacific Americans were not allowed to serve in the armed forces until after the outbreak of World War II, David S.C. Chu, undersecretary of defense for personnel and readiness, told the audience at the third annual Asian-Pacific American Federal Career Advancement Summit May 10 in Arlington, Va.
